In this video, Er. Fazal ur Rahman, a Corporate Trainer at Civil Guruji, explains why highways are built at elevated heights compared to regular roads. You'll learn about the materials used to elevate highways and the processes involved in building a strong sub-grade. 🚧 Key Takeaways:
✅ Importance of elevated highways for connectivity and growth.
✅ Historical background and evolution of highway construction.
✅ Factors influencing highway elevation, including terrain selection and maximum flood levels.
✅ Materials used for elevating highways, such as fly ash, soil particles, and gravel.
✅ Importance of proper sub-grade preparation and compaction techniques.
